Water is introduced into the clarifier tank. 2. Skimmers remove the inorganic materials (scum) floating on the surface. 3. A rake collects the settling sludge at the bottom, which is subsequently removed by the sludge removal system. 4. Biologically treated effluent flows out of the clarifier via a weir.
